Bouteilles de Klein in Monsieur Délire

“Listening Diary”, François Couture, Monsieur Délire, December 1, 2010
Wednesday, December 1, 2010 Press

I’m fond of Natasha Barrett. Her electroacoustic compositions have bite, subtlety, and depth. Her art is serious but welcoming. Bouteilles de Klein is her second album for empreintes DIGITALes. It is a 2-DVD set (stereo and surround mixes, high fidelity), 140 minutes of concert works and sound installations. The installations disc (the second) is nice but less captivating than the concert works disc which holds lots of highlights. I’d be hard press to choose a favorite between the recomposed field recordings of Microclimates III-VI and the orgiastic electroacoustics of Avoid Being Eaten by Mimicking Other Less Palatable Species (ABEMOLPAS) (now there’s a program of sonic mimicry!). Heartily recommended.
